Coming Soon! Google Meet Controls. These controls allow you to mute chat, and share screen. We expect these to be released any day. Google has released these to the Enterprise Editions on Sept 1, 2020 and they will roll them out for EDU within 14 days.
Here is a link to the updates coming to Google Meet. Some of the updates include:
250 Participants & 100,000 ViewersHand Raising
Custom Backgrounds
Meet Attendance
Breakout Rooms
Q & A
Polling
Meet Controls (see more to the left)
Jamboard Integration
